Does Insurance Cover Testosterone Therapy?

Yes, many plans cover TRT when medically necessary. In the United States, Medicare and private insurers typically approve coverage if blood tests confirm levels below 300 ng/dL plus documented symptoms like obesity, erectile dysfunction, or reduced bone density. Diagnosis often requires two morning tests plus ruling out other conditions. However, coverage varies by state, employer plan, and whether it's labeled “age-related decline” versus clinical hypogonadism.

Certified coaches recommend starting with your primary care physician or an endocrinologist who understands metabolic health. Request a full hormone panel including free testosterone, SHBG, estradiol, and PSA. Documenting failed weight loss attempts, elevated A1C, or joint limitations strengthens the case for coverage. Avoid cash-pay clinics initially if cost is a barrier—many middle-income clients secure 80-100% coverage after proper documentation.

What Certified Weight Loss Coaches Actually Recommend

TRT is not a magic bullet, but when combined with lifestyle changes it accelerates results. Coaches following evidence-based protocols suggest pairing therapy with resistance training 3 times weekly (even chair-based versions for joint pain), 7,000-9,000 daily steps, and a protein-forward meal plan of 1.6g per kg body weight. In The CFP Weight Loss Method, we emphasize sleep optimization and stress reduction because cortisol competes with testosterone.

Monitor progress every 6-8 weeks: expect 5-10% body fat reduction in the first 3 months when hormones stabilize. For clients overwhelmed by conflicting nutrition advice, we simplify to three-plate method meals—no tracking apps required. Always coordinate with your prescribing doctor; unmanaged estrogen conversion can worsen symptoms.

💬 What the Community Says

In online forums and Facebook groups for midlife weight loss, opinions on insurance-covered testosterone are sharply divided. Many men over 45 share success stories of losing 20-40 pounds after TRT approval, reporting less joint pain and easier blood sugar control. They often praise doctors who order proper labs and fight for coverage. However, a vocal group warns about long-term dependency, high hematocrit risks, and clinics pushing expensive pellets instead of covered injections. Women in the same communities express frustration that similar hormonal help for menopause is rarely covered. Beginners frequently ask how to talk to doctors without sounding like they're seeking performance enhancers. Most practitioners note that lifestyle changes remain essential—TRT alone rarely works without diet and movement adjustments. Insurance denials are a common complaint, leading some to pay out-of-pocket despite financial strain. Overall, the community views medically supervised testosterone as potentially helpful but stresses the need for realistic expectations and integrated coaching.
